Description:
The NTE914 zero–voltage switch is a monolithic silicon integrated circuit in a 14–Lead DIP type pack­age designed to control a thyristor in a variety of AC power switching applications for AC input voltages of 24V, 120V, 208/230V, and 277V at 50/60Hz and 400Hz. AC cycle is at zero voltage point; thereby eliminating radio–frequency interference (RFI) when used with resistive loads.
TRIAC Gating Circuit: Provides high current pulses to the gate of the power controlling thyristor.
The NTE914 also provides the following important auxiliary functions:
A built–in protection circuit that may be actuated to remove drive from the TRIAC if the sensor opens or shorts.
Thyristor firing may be inhibited through the acting of an internal diode gate connected to Pin1. High–power DC comparator operation is provided by overriding the action of the zero–crossing
detector. This is accomplished by connecting Pin12 to Pin7. Gate current to the thyristor is continuous when Pin13 is positive with respect to Pin9.
